Docker是目前最受歡迎的容器化引擎之一,其提供了一種虛擬化技術,使得應用程序可以在不同的環境中運行。Docker通過將應用程序及其依賴項打包為容器來實現這一目標,使得應用程序的部署、移植及管理變得更加容易。
Docker的另一個顯著特點是其輕量級和快速啟動能力。由于Docker容器是輕量級的,每一個容器只運行應用程序及其依賴項。這種輕量級技術可以幫助開發人員在不同的環境中快速部署和運行應用程序,從而提高了應用程序的可移植性,并降低了部署應用程序的成本。
然而,Docker的學習曲線仍然比較陡峭,尤其是對于初學者而言。為了解決這個問題,Docker-D成為了Docker的一個出色工具。Docker-D是一個Docker的Web界面,可以在瀏覽器中使用,并幫助用戶方便地管理Docker容器、鏡像、網絡等各種資源。
$ docker run -dit --name docker-d -p 8080:8080 \
-v /var/run/docker.sock:/var/run/docker.sock docker-d/docker-d
通過使用Docker-D,用戶可以簡化容器的創建、部署和管理,并且更加方便地查看容器狀態、網絡配置等相關信息。Docker-D的用戶界面友好、直觀,減少了用戶對Docker本身的學習難度,使得Docker更加容易被廣泛使用。
總之,Docker-D是一個優秀的Docker管理工具,能夠幫助開發人員簡化Docker容器的創建、部署和管理,從而使得Docker更加容易被廣泛應用。